Oh, yeah. Getting @trusted right is hard. Getting it right when 
user-provided types are involved is extra hard, because you can't even 
trust fundamental operations like assignment or copying.

Please note that the allocator stuff is just one of the three violations 
I had pointed out. You've already pushed a fix for the unsafe .stringz, 
but you haven't addressed unsafe copy constructors yet.

And my list wasn't meant to be complete. There may be other safety holes 
I didn't notice.
